摘要: #!/usr/bin/env python # _*_coding:utf-8_*_ import boto3 import json import sys class Elbv2(): def __init__(self,**kwargs): self.app = kwargs['app'] se 阅读全文
posted @ 2019-11-13 22:53 MR_dy 阅读(321) 评论(0) 推荐(0) 编辑
摘要: #!/usr/bin/env python #coding=utf-8 import json import ast import smtplib from aliyunsdkcore.client import AcsClient from aliyunsdkcore.acs_exception. 阅读全文
posted @ 2019-11-13 22:48 MR_dy 阅读(666) 评论(0) 推荐(0) 编辑
摘要: 官网地址:https://wiki.jenkins.io/display/JENKINS/Building+a+software+project#Buildingasoftwareproject-JenkinsSetEnvironmentVariables 参考文档使用:https://blog.c 阅读全文
posted @ 2019-06-14 11:15 MR_dy 阅读(3000) 评论(0) 推荐(0) 编辑
摘要: 1.检查脚本是否有语法错误 bash -n test.sh 2.检查脚本执行过程 /bin/sh set -x 是开启 set +x是关闭 set -o是查看 (xtrace),set去追中一段代码的显示情况。 set指令能设置所使用shell的执行方式,可依照不同的需求来做设置 -a 标示已修改的 阅读全文
posted @ 2019-05-30 11:08 MR_dy 阅读(880) 评论(0) 推荐(0) 编辑
摘要: 语法含义: $$Shell本身的PID(ProcessID)$!Shell最后运行的后台Process的PID$?最后运行的命令的结束代码(返回值)$-使用Set命令设定的Flag一览$*所有参数列表。如"$*"用「"」括起来的情况、以"$1 $2 … $n"的形式输出所有参数。$@所有参数列表。如 阅读全文
posted @ 2019-05-23 19:33 MR_dy 阅读(368) 评论(0) 推荐(0) 编辑
摘要: 本文转自博客园:惨绿少年@clsn.io  链接地址:https://www.cnblogs.com/clsn/p/7885990.html#auto_id_67 阅读全文
posted @ 2019-03-20 18:30 MR_dy 阅读(114) 评论(0) 推荐(0) 编辑
摘要: 1 #!/bin/bash 2 3 who am i 4 # 部署jar包通过cli的形式 5 set -x 6 7 #获取线上服务端口 8 PORT=$2 9 10 15 16 # 负载均衡目标组ID:register-targets 17 targets_arn="arn:aws:xxxxxxxx/elbwan-prod-mqtt-001/... 阅读全文
posted @ 2018-11-21 15:37 MR_dy 阅读(544) 评论(0) 推荐(0) 编辑
摘要: #!/bin/bash #CHANNEL为系统名,根据jenkins的路径来判断 PWD=`pwd` #CHANNEL=`echo $PWD| awk -F'/' '{print $5}' | awk -F'_' '{print $2}'` CHANNEL=$1 #REMOTEIP 部署的远程ip REMOTEIP=${@:2} #REMOTEDIR 远程目录 REMOTEDIR="/apps/... 阅读全文
posted @ 2018-08-15 11:19 MR_dy 阅读(603) 评论(0) 推荐(0) 编辑
摘要: #!/bin/bash # 接收服务名 PJT_name=$1 PJT_DIR=/apps/project/ # 接受 start status stop 参数 service=$2 # 获取主机名判断Eureka服务启动的 参数 HOSTNAME=`hostname` dic=("grab_cycle_eureka" "grab_cycle_ubikeuser1" "grab_cycle_c... 阅读全文
posted @ 2018-08-15 11:15 MR_dy 阅读(1299) 评论(0) 推荐(0) 编辑
摘要: Json & pickle模块 1.Json 和 pickle的区别: Json:跨平台性强,可以在多平台上使用 Pickle:只能在python中使用 Json:只能存字符串格式的json,pickle都可以存 2.json序列化: 例子:写入:保存文件的内容为json格式的字符串内容 例子:在文 阅读全文
posted @ 2018-08-14 19:37 MR_dy 阅读(167) 评论(0) 推荐(0) 编辑